codec: document that omitempty is ignored with toarray

Fixes #198

@@ -1027,6 +1027,8 @@ func (e *Encoder) ResetBytes(out *[]byte) {
 // However, struct values may encode as arrays. This happens when:
 //    - StructToArray Encode option is set, OR
 //    - the tag on the _struct field sets the "toarray" option
+// Note that omitempty is ignored when encoding struct values as arrays,
+// as an entry must be encoded for each field, to maintain its position.
